[reaction: see text] A series of substituted chlorotetrazines were reacted with different terminal alkynes under Sonogashira or Negishi coupling conditions to furnish alkynyl-tetrazines in good to moderate yield. The electron-donating properties of the substituent on the tetrazine core were found to have a significant influence on the success of the reaction. These results constitute the first cross-coupling reactions on tetrazines.
